简介:
以下从实例的角度来测试一遍hop window(滑动窗口),这里使用了官方文档中窗口函数的表结构及数据,从实际操作来看滑动窗口何时开启关闭,以及watermark对窗口的作用。
环境:
CDH6.3.1
FLINK1.4.0
CentOS7.6
PYTHON3.7.6
表结构及数据引用:
测试步骤:
1. 在kafka中创建topic:
# cd /opt/cloudera/parcels/CDH-6.3.1-1.cdh6.3.1.p0.1470567/lib/kafka/bin/
# ./kafka-topics.sh --create --zookeeper node1.example.com:2181,node2.example.com:2181,node3.example.com:2181 --replication-factor 1 --partitions 1 --topic bid
2. 在sql client中创建source表:
本文通过一个实例详细介绍了如何在 Flink 中使用 Hop Window 进行数据处理,包括创建 Kafka topic、设置 Hive 表、定义 Watermark,并通过 SQL 查询演示了 Hop Window 的实时计算过程,解释了窗口开启、关闭的逻辑以及 Watermark 对窗口的影响。
订阅专栏 解锁全文
313

被折叠的 条评论
为什么被折叠?



